[0001] The invention relates to the field of liquid crystal display, in particular to a liquid crystal display device with a wide viewing angle. Background technique
[0002] Liquid crystal display devices are widely used in handheld information exchange terminals and various display fields because of their low space occupation rate and low energy consumption. The liquid crystal display device controls the alignment direction of liquid crystal molecules when the light from the light source passes through the liquid crystal layer through an electric field, and changes the transmittance to display images. According to different specific principles, the liquid crystal display device has developed from the early TN mode to the current vertical alignment (VA) mode and in-plane switching (In-Plane Switching, IPS) mode.
